What Are the Key Features of the Best Blood Glucose Monitoring Systems?

The best blood glucose monitoring systems in the UK are characterized by several key features that enhance usability, accuracy, and connectivity.

  • Accuracy: Reliable blood glucose monitoring systems provide precise readings that are consistent with laboratory tests. High accuracy is crucial for proper diabetes management, as it allows users to make informed decisions regarding their diet and medication.
  • Ease of Use: The best systems are designed for user-friendliness, featuring intuitive interfaces and simple instructions. This includes easy-to-read displays and straightforward testing procedures, making it accessible for users of all ages and tech-savviness.
  • Data Management: Advanced monitoring systems often come with software or apps that help track blood glucose levels over time. This feature allows users to analyze trends and share data with healthcare providers, facilitating better management of their condition.
  • Connectivity: Many modern devices offer Bluetooth or Wi-Fi connectivity, enabling seamless integration with smartphones and other devices. This connectivity allows for real-time data tracking, alerts, and reminders, improving the overall diabetes management experience.
  • Test Strip Availability: A good monitoring system should have easily accessible and affordable test strips. The availability of strips ensures that users can regularly monitor their glucose levels without excessive costs or inconvenience.
  • Size and Portability: Compact and portable designs are essential for users who need to monitor their glucose levels on the go. Lightweight systems that fit easily in a pocket or bag encourage consistent monitoring throughout the day.
  • Additional Features: Some of the best systems may include features like continuous glucose monitoring (CGM), alarms for high or low levels, and customizable settings for individual needs. These additional features can significantly enhance the management of diabetes, providing users with more control over their health.

How Does the Cost of Blood Glucose Monitoring Systems Vary in the UK?

The cost of blood glucose monitoring systems in the UK can vary significantly based on several factors, including the type of device, brand, and additional features.

  • Traditional Glucometers: These are the most common and typically the least expensive option available. The devices themselves can cost anywhere from £10 to £50, but users will also need to purchase test strips regularly, which can add an ongoing monthly expense of £20 to £50 depending on usage.
  • Continuous Glucose Monitors (CGMs): CGMs are more advanced systems that provide real-time glucose readings without the need for finger pricks. These systems can be significantly more expensive, with initial costs ranging from £400 to £1,000, plus recurring costs for sensors that can be around £100 per month.
  • Flash Glucose Monitors: These devices allow users to scan a sensor attached to the skin for glucose readings. The initial cost of the reader is usually around £60 to £100, while the sensors are typically priced at about £50 each and need to be replaced every two weeks, leading to ongoing costs.
  • Smart Glucometers: These devices connect to smartphones or tablets and offer features like data tracking and sharing. Prices can vary widely from £30 to £150 depending on the brand and features, and users must also consider the cost of test strips, which can add to the total expense.
  • Insurance and NHS Coverage: In the UK, some blood glucose monitoring systems may be covered by the NHS, especially for individuals with specific medical conditions. This can greatly reduce out-of-pocket costs, but eligibility and coverage can vary, making it essential to check with healthcare providers.

What Are the Latest Innovations in Blood Glucose Monitoring Technology?

The latest innovations in blood glucose monitoring technology include:

  • Continuous Glucose Monitoring (CGM) Systems: These devices provide real-time glucose readings throughout the day and night, allowing users to track their blood glucose levels continuously.
  • Smart Insulin Pens: These pens not only deliver insulin but also log data on doses, timing, and carbohydrate intake, linking to apps for better management.
  • Non-invasive Monitoring Devices: Emerging technologies are focusing on non-invasive methods, such as using infrared sensors or sweat analysis, to measure glucose levels without the need for finger pricks.
  • Integration with Mobile Apps and Wearables: Many glucose monitoring systems are now compatible with smartphones and wearables, enabling seamless data tracking and personalized insights.
  • Artificial Intelligence and Machine Learning: AI is being used to analyze glucose data, predict trends, and provide personalized recommendations for users based on their unique patterns.

Continuous Glucose Monitoring (CGM) Systems are revolutionizing diabetes care by offering users the ability to monitor their blood glucose levels in real-time. This technology features a small sensor placed under the skin that measures glucose levels in the interstitial fluid, providing alerts for any significant highs or lows, which is crucial for proactive management.

Smart Insulin Pens represent another significant advancement, as they help users to manage their insulin delivery more effectively. These pens track dosage and timing, and many connect to smartphone applications, allowing users to have a comprehensive view of their insulin therapy and helping to improve adherence to treatment plans.

Non-invasive Monitoring Devices are gaining attention for their potential to eliminate the discomfort associated with traditional blood glucose testing. Innovations in this area focus on using light or other technologies to measure glucose levels through the skin or other means, offering a pain-free alternative for users.

Integration with Mobile Apps and Wearables enhances the user experience by allowing individuals to store and analyze their glucose data easily. This connectivity enables users to receive alerts and insights, track their dietary habits, and communicate more efficiently with healthcare providers about their diabetes management.

Artificial Intelligence and Machine Learning are playing a pivotal role in optimizing diabetes care. By analyzing vast amounts of data collected from glucose monitoring devices, AI can identify patterns that help forecast glucose fluctuations, allowing for more personalized management strategies tailored to individual needs.
